Druk Air
Drukair, also known as Royal Bhutan Airlines, is the national flag carrier of Bhutan, established in 1981. It operates scheduled flights to various international destinations within the South Asian region, including Delhi, Kathmandu, and Bangkok, from its base at Paro International Airport. Drukair also provides domestic services within Bhutan.
National Carrier:Drukair is the first airline registered with the Department of Air Transport in Bhutan and is owned by the Royal Government of Bhutan.
International Network:The airline serves 10 international destinations across 6 countries, including India, Nepal, Thailand, and Singapore and Drukair operates flights to three domestic airports within Bhutan, connecting Paro with Bumthang, Gelephu, and Yonphula.
Bhutan Airline
Bhutan Airlines, also known as Tashi Air Pvt. Ltd, is Bhutan’s first private airline, established in 2013. It operates international flights connecting Paro (Bhutan) with destinations like Bangkok, Kolkata, and Kathmandu.
Bhutan Airlines plays a significant role in Bhutan’s aviation sector, offering a reliable and competitive alternative to the national carrier, Drukair.
Founding and Operations: Bhutan Airlines was founded by the Tashi Group of Companies and began international operations in 2013 with an Airbus A320, later transitioning to an Airbus A319.

Heli Bhutan is the first private helicopter service in Bhutan, offers high-altitude flights to remote destinations with a brand-new Airbus H-125.
Based in Ramtokto, Thimphu, Heli Bhutan introduces a dynamic alternative to the state-run Royal Bhutan Helicopter Services Limited. With growing demand for both routine and emergency aerial services, the arrival of a private operator is poised to ease pressure on existing resources.
Launched on 22 April 2025, Heli Bhutan has already completed flights to over eight destinations—including remote and mountainous areas like Jomolhari, Sombaykha, Gasa, and Laya—within its first 18 days of service.
CEO Chencho Dorji shared that the service is performing above initial projections, averaging four to five flight hours per day. The company uses a high-altitude Airbus H-125 helicopter, capable of seating six passengers and navigating Bhutan’s rugged terrain with ease.
